#KouriRichins #EricRichins #CrimesWithChronicle A Utah mother who wrote a children’s book to help her sons grieve the death of their father is now standing trial for his murder. In this video, I break down the full case against Kouri Richins, who prosecutors say poisoned her husband, Eric Richins, with fentanyl in March 2022. Months after his death, she published a children’s book about grief — a decision that later became a focal point of public scrutiny when criminal charges were filed. According to the State of Utah, this case is not about a tragic accident, but about money, motive, and timing. Prosecutors allege Kouri Richins was buried under millions of dollars in debt, blocked from a significant financial payout by a prenuptial agreement, and involved in a relationship outside her marriage — all while facing mounting financial pressure. They argue that Eric’s death would unlock access to insurance proceeds, property, and a “fresh start” divorce could not provide.
